ARTHUR SEREDUIK Peacefully on October 20, 2006 after a brief battle with cancer, Arthur Sereduik, aged 78, went Home to God. Dad was born on August 26, 1928 in Winnipeg, MB. He was predeceased by his wife Bobbie; his parents John and Jessie Serediuk; his brother Nicholas, and his sister Joyce Maryk. Left to mourn his passing and to honour his life are his son John Sereduik and wife Jacqueline; his daughter Sandra Lussier, husband Ken and granddaughter Kayleen Lussier. Also left to mourn his passing, his niece Darlene McKay and husband Brad, nephew Kevin Maryk, great-nieces Ariel, Erica, and Abby, great-nephews Cody and Dominic. After growing up in Elmwood, Dad pursued a career in accounting, eventually becoming comptroller for Bay Bronze Industries. It was at this time that he began going for Wednesday lunches at Luigi's with his friends from work. This tradition continued for 26 years up until his passing. Before and after his retirement in 1990, Dad enjoyed the Downs, the casino, and travel, which took him to places such as Texas, Florida, the Caribbean, and Las Vegas. Even at home, he always knew the temperature in Vegas .
